Feral Farm Permaculture Design Course

June 14th to June 27th, 2010

This year we're doing a 2 week intensive Permaculture Design Course at Feral Farm. We will cover 72 hours of permaculture curriculum along with over 10 hours of primitives skills and wilderness awareness.

Topics covered include agro-ecology, site assessment, design methodology, utilizing natural patterns, forest gardening, mushroom propagation, water catchment and greywater systems, natural building and shelter construction, emergency preparedness, renewable energy, appropriate technology, sustainable economics and local currency, wild edible & medicinal plants, indigenous land management, tracking and awareness, fire making, and much more.

Our course is held at Feral Farm, located in the beautiful Sauk River valley, just outside of Rockport, WA. Instructors include David Zhang, Laura Donahue, Heidi Bohan, Michael Pilarski, Matt van Boven and other special guests.
